Dear colleagues, We are conducting a systematic review examining the relationship between = the use of AI systems (e.g., chatbots, conversational agents and large la= nguage models) and social well-being outcomes such as loneliness, social = connection, and related interpersonal outcomes. To ensure comprehensive coverage of the literature, we are seeking both p= ublished and unpublished work. This includes manuscripts under review, wo= rking papers, preprints, theses, dissertations, or ongoing studies. Studies may be relevant if they: 1. Examine the use of AI systems (e.g., chatbots, conversational agents, = large language models, or similar tools), excluding clinical or therapeut= ic chatbot interventions. 2. Measure outcomes related to social well-being (e.g., loneliness, socia= l connection, interpersonal well-being) 3. Provide quantitative data or results that allow effect sizes to be com= puted. We welcome both experimental and observational studies involving human pa= rticipants. If you have work that may be relevant, we would greatly appreciate it if = you could share it through the form below: https://forms.gle/5AyeNSoTYeTgqdYEA Please upload a file containing relevant study details, including well-be= ing measures, sample characteristics, and all effect sizes related to soc= ial well-being. If uploading a dataset, please include a codebook. Null or negative findings are equally valuable for this review.
